My son Kyle died six years ago, when we were in a car accident while driving through Newbrunswick returning from vacation on PEI.
He was just 17 years old. Kyle was an incredible person and his loss completely shattered my life. Six years ago I was a shell of the person I am now and my only desire was to trade places with my son.
In an effort to somehow heal and find reasons to keep going, I began to fundraise in Kyle’s honour. It’s amazing the healing power of fundraising. We’ve done some truly amazing things, which include building a private family waiting room at Saint John Regional hospital, where Kyle spent more than a week in a coma.
I’ve been in school for five years studying Social Work, Life Skills Coaching and Grief/ Bereavement Counselling, so I can help support the grieving.
My goal this winter is to provide free Lifeskills workshops for people suffering with grief and trauma. The five hour healing workshops will include a healthy meal and a gentle yoga session at the end.
I decided to forgo a Team Kyle walk and try a gofundme campaign this year. This will allow me to put my energy into the workshops and helping people first hand.
My goal is to raise $2,000.00 so I can bring the workshops to various community service agencies in the GTA.
